Ramp to I-95 Reopens at MD 24

The crash impacted drivers headed south on Interstate 95.

The ramp to Interstate 95 south has reopened following a crash in Harford County Thursday morning, according to the Maryland Transportation Authority.

At approximately 8:15 a.m., the authority reported the ramp from MD 24 to I-95 south was clear.

A collision involving two vehicles was reported at 7:30 a.m. in the area, and as first responders handled the cleanup, the ramp from MD 24 had been blocked, according to the Coordinated Highways Action Response Team (CHART).
